Nota
L'accesso a questa pagina richiede l'autorizzazione. È possibile provare ad accedere o modificare le directory.
L'accesso a questa pagina richiede l'autorizzazione. È possibile provare a modificare le directory.
L'enumerazione TRANSACTION_OUTCOME definisce i risultati (risultati) che KTM può assegnare a una transazione.
Sintassi
typedef enum _TRANSACTION_OUTCOME {
TransactionOutcomeUndetermined,
TransactionOutcomeCommitted,
TransactionOutcomeAborted
} TRANSACTION_OUTCOME;
Costanti
TransactionOutcomeUndeterminedLa transazione non è ancora stata sottoposta a commit o è stato eseguito il rollback. |
TransactionOutcomeCommittedÈ stato eseguito il commit della transazione. |
TransactionOutcomeAbortedÈ stato eseguito il rollback della transazione. |
Osservazioni
L'enumerazione TRANSACTION_OUTCOME viene utilizzata nella struttura TRANSACTION_BASIC_INFORMATION.
Fabbisogno
| Requisito | Valore |
|---|---|
| client minimo supportato | Disponibile in Windows Vista e versioni successive del sistema operativo. |
| intestazione | wdm.h (include Wdm.h, Ntddk.h, Ntifs.h) |